What the Utah data shows for Water Well Drillers
Utah's path to water well driller licensure runs through board-approved instruction and a passing score on a state-approved exam. Utah folds the credential into its broader occupational licensing statute, which classifies the training track as "Training/Certification".
Upfront cost is $50 on a 3-year cycle. Continuing education is not a listed requirement for this profession in Utah, so the annualized maintenance burden is lower than in states that mandate ongoing hours.
Utah evaluates out-of-state credentials case-by-case rather than through a published reciprocity list.
